Exploring the Emergence of Five-Finger Humanoid Manipulators and Their Revolutionary Impact on Modern Robotic Applications Across Diverse Industrial Sectors Worldwide
The field of robotics has seen remarkable progress over the past decade, moving well beyond traditional industrial arms to embrace human-like dexterity and adaptability. Among these innovations, five-fingered humanoid manipulators have emerged as a transformative technology, bridging the gap between rigid automation and nuanced human interaction. Unlike conventional grippers or simple two-finger end effectors, these advanced robotic hands can perform complex tasks such as delicate assembly, precise inspection, and human-like object manipulation. As a result, they are redefining automation possibilities across multiple sectors, enabling new use cases and enhancing productivity in previously inaccessible applications.
Recent strides in actuation, sensing, and control algorithms have accelerated the maturation of five-fingered humanoid manipulators. High-torque, low-profile actuators now deliver the fine force control necessary for handling fragile components, while integrated tactile sensors provide real-time feedback on contact forces and surface characteristics. Combined with sophisticated motion planning and machine learning–driven grasp generation, these manipulators can adapt autonomously to variations in object geometry and environmental conditions. Consequently, they are no longer confined to controlled research labs but are increasingly deployed on factory floors, in healthcare settings, and even in field environments.
Despite these advances, integrating five-fingered manipulators into existing automation workflows presents several challenges, including system complexity, programming effort, and total cost of ownership. However, early adopters are uncovering compelling efficiency gains, improved ergonomics, and heightened safety through collaborative deployments alongside human workers. Analyzing the Key Technological and Market Dynamics Driving the Transformation of Five-Fingered Humanoid Manipulator Innovations in Recent Years and Their Implications for Future Industrial Automation Strategies Worldwide
Over the last few years, the landscape of five-fingered humanoid manipulators has undergone pivotal transformation driven by breakthroughs in machine learning, sensor fusion, and lightweight composite materials. At the forefront, reinforcement learning–based grasp strategies have empowered robots to improve performance iteratively from trial data, reducing dependency on exhaustive programming. The emergence of high-density sensor arrays, encompassing tactile, force-torque, and proximity modalities, has further enhanced perception capabilities, enabling manipulators to detect slippage, comply with unstructured surfaces, and safely interact with humans.
Material innovation has equally influenced the field, with advanced polymers and carbon fiber composites yielding end effectors that are both strong and lightweight. Combined with integrated haptic feedback loops, these materials enable more delicate handling of complex geometries and fragile items. Furthermore, developments in modular actuation systems allow manufacturers to rapidly customize hand configurations to specific form factors and payload requirements, thus accelerating time-to-market.
In parallel, the proliferation of digital twin platforms and cloud-based orchestration has transformed how organizations design, simulate, and monitor humanoid manipulator deployments. Real-time analytics and remote update capabilities streamline maintenance and performance tuning, reducing downtime. Meanwhile, cross-industry collaborations between robotics firms, academic institutions, and standards bodies are creating interoperable protocols that facilitate multi-vendor ecosystem development. Collectively, these transformative shifts are not only redefining technical capabilities but also reshaping commercial adoption strategies and investment priorities across sectors.
Assessing the Comprehensive Effects of United States Tariff Measures in 2025 on the Development, Sourcing, and Adoption of Five-Fingered Humanoid Manipulation Systems
In 2025, the United States enacted a series of tariffs targeting key robotics components imported from major manufacturing hubs in Asia and Europe, marking a significant policy shift with far-reaching supply chain implications. These duties, applied to actuators, sensors, precision controllers, and other critical hardware, have introduced additional cost layers that ripple throughout the integration and deployment of five-fingered humanoid systems. As a result, original equipment manufacturers and integrators are reassessing sourcing strategies in response to elevated landed costs and elongated lead times.
Under these conditions, several domestic automation firms have accelerated investments in local manufacturing of essential components, spanning from motor assemblies to high-resolution cameras. This reshoring trend aims to mitigate tariff exposure while fostering supply chain resilience. However, ramping up domestic capacity has necessitated significant capital outlays and collaboration with industrial foundries and semiconductor fabs to meet rigorous performance specifications. Consequently, project timelines for new installations have stretched, prompting organizations to explore hybrid sourcing models that balance lower-cost offshore production with nearshoring and onshore backup inventories.
In addition to hardware, tariffs have indirectly affected the pricing and availability of vision systems, simulation software licenses, and other intangible assets vital to deploying sophisticated five-fingered manipulators. To navigate these headwinds, industry participants are negotiating strategic partnerships and license-sharing agreements, as well as investing in open-source algorithm development to reduce dependency on proprietary offerings. Overall, the cumulative impact of 2025 tariffs is catalyzing a reconfiguration of global supply networks and prompting innovative approaches to cost containment and risk management.
Uncovering Detailed Sectoral and Functional Segmentation Insights to Illuminate Growth Opportunities and Commercial Viability of Five-Fingered Humanoid Robotics Markets
Detailed segmentation analysis reveals that end-user industries such as automotive, electronics, and healthcare are driving demand for precision dexterity solutions, whereas logistics and consumer goods sectors increasingly leverage robotic hands for material handling and packaging tasks that require adaptive grip strategies. In the automotive sector, five-fingered manipulators enhance assembly line flexibility by accommodating variant chassis components, while in electronics, they facilitate delicate circuit board manipulations that were previously reliant on custom tooling. Similarly, in healthcare settings, the ability to mimic human finger articulation enables surgical robotics applications and patient assistance devices.
Component segmentation underscores the interplay between hardware, services, software, and vision systems in shaping total value propositions. Hardware elements, including actuators, controllers, end effectors, and sensors, represent the foundational mechanics of hand performance, whereas consulting, installation, maintenance, and training services ensure seamless integration and operator proficiency. Software modules for control, motion planning, and simulation empower engineers to generate robust grasp strategies and validate system behavior before physical deployment. Meanwhile, two-dimensional and three-dimensional vision solutions feed real-time perceptual data that guide adaptive grasp control and environment mapping.
Application-specific segmentation further refines insights by highlighting how assembly, inspection, material handling, packaging, pick-and-place, and welding processes each impose distinct performance criteria. For instance, high-speed bulk pick-and-place tasks prioritize cycle time and reliability, whereas precision pick-and-place demands submillimeter positional accuracy. Inspection applications demand nuanced visual and tactile sensing to detect surface defects or dimensional deviations. Collectively, these segmentation perspectives offer a granular understanding of commercial viability and technical requirements for five-fingered humanoid manipulator solutions.

Mapping Regional Trends and Strategic Considerations Across the Americas, EMEA, and Asia-Pacific to Optimize Deployment of Five-Fingered Humanoid Manipulator Solutions
Regional dynamics play a critical role in shaping the adoption trajectory of five-fingered humanoid manipulators, with distinct market drivers present in the Americas, Europe Middle East & Africa, and Asia-Pacific regions. In the Americas, strong government incentives for advanced manufacturing and extensive industrial automation infrastructure support pilot deployments in automotive assembly and consumer goods production. North American research institutions are also partnering with robotics firms to co-develop next-generation tactile sensors, fostering a collaborative innovation ecosystem.
In the Europe, Middle East & Africa region, regulatory frameworks emphasizing safety and human–machine collaboration have accelerated the uptake of cobotic hands, particularly in industries such as defense and logistics. European Union funding programs directed at robotics standardization and interoperability are facilitating multi-country consortium projects, while Middle Eastern sovereign wealth initiatives are channeling substantial capital into automated warehouse solutions. The EMEA market is characterized by a balanced demand across both established manufacturing hubs and emerging economies seeking to leapfrog conventional automation paradigms.
The Asia-Pacific region remains a powerhouse for robotics production and deployment, driven by high-volume electronics manufacturing clusters in East Asia and rapidly expanding e-commerce logistics networks in Southeast Asia. Domestic champions in robotics hardware and software continue to expand their footprint through joint ventures and direct investments. Meanwhile, Southeast Asian governments are rolling out robotics adoption roadmaps to alleviate labor shortages and improve supply chain resiliency. Taken together, these regional insights underscore the varied strategic approaches needed to capitalize on localized opportunities in the global five-fingered manipulator arena.
